The Booming Landscape of Unblocked Browser Games: Accessibility and Entertainment

The popularity of unblocked games cannot be overstated. These are titles that have been specifically designed or curated to be accessible through a standard web browser, bypassing the need for downloads, installations, or specialized software. This fundamental characteristic makes them incredibly appealing to a broad audience, particularly those who face limitations on their internet access.

Imagine a student during a study hall, an office worker on a break, or anyone in a location with stringent network policies. For them, the ability to open a browser tab and dive into a game like “Agar.io,” “Slither.io,” “Krunker.io,” or countless others, provides a vital avenue for relaxation and mental diversion. The term “web-based” emphasizes this core functionality – games that run entirely within the confines of the browser window, utilizing technologies like HTML5, JavaScript, and WebGL. This ensures compatibility across a wide range of devices and operating systems, from Windows PCs and Macs to Chromebooks and even some mobile devices.

The “unblocked” aspect is the critical differentiator. Many institutional or corporate networks implement firewalls and content filters designed to prevent access to non-work-related websites, including gaming portals. Unblocked games often reside on servers that are not on these restricted lists, or they utilize ingenious methods to disguise their traffic, allowing users to bypass these restrictions. This has led to a thriving ecosystem of websites dedicated to hosting and providing access to these very games, often organized by genre, popularity, or new additions.

The appeal lies in their immediate accessibility and often simple, yet engaging, gameplay mechanics. Many browser games are designed for short bursts of play, perfect for quick breaks. They don’t require deep commitment or lengthy tutorials, making them easy to pick up and play. This immediacy, coupled with the thrill of competition or puzzle-solving, is a powerful draw for millions of users worldwide. The Rise of .io Games and Their Impact on Unblocked Play

The phenomenon of .io games has profoundly shaped the landscape of unblocked browser games. These games, characterized by their domain extensions, often feature minimalistic graphics, simple controls, and massively multiplayer online gameplay. Titles like “Agar.io,” “Slither.io,” “Diep.io,” “Krunker.io,” and “Surviv.io” became overnight sensations, largely due to their inherent suitability for the browser game model.

The appeal of these games lies in their elegant simplicity. “Agar.io,” for instance, is a game where players control a cell, absorbing smaller cells to grow larger while avoiding being absorbed by larger opponents. The mechanics are incredibly straightforward, yet the emergent gameplay, driven by player interaction and strategic maneuvering, creates a surprisingly deep and competitive experience. Similarly, “Slither.io” tasks players with growing their snake by consuming glowing orbs, while strategically trapping and consuming other players.

What makes these .io games particularly effective in the unblocked games market is their low barrier to entry. They require no registration to play (though accounts can often be created for persistent progress, much like User:Raynix might have done), load quickly, and run smoothly on most systems. Their inherent competitiveness, with global leaderboards and the constant threat of being outmaneuvered by another player, fosters a highly engaging and addictive loop.

The success of the .io genre demonstrated a powerful demand for accessible, multiplayer web-based games. This paved the way for countless other developers to create similar titles, expanding the variety and depth of unblocked browser games available to users.
